Get to Know Climeworks
Climeworks is a leading provider of high-quality carbon removal solutions, with decades of expertise in Direct Air Capture (DAC) technology. Our holistic approach combines nature-based and engineered methods to support companies in achieving their net-zero goals.
Operating the world's first two DAC plants in Iceland, Climeworks showcases its commitment to high-quality carbon removal, which is backed by over 15 years of innovative research, development, and deployment.
